migrating datetime api for session
This commit is contained in:
parent
c4354c1ff1
commit
9520b4ce48
52 changed files with 435 additions and 332 deletions
|
|
@ -19,11 +19,13 @@ use Apache2::Request;
|
|||
use WebGUI::Config;
|
||||
use WebGUI::SQL;
|
||||
use WebGUI::User;
|
||||
use WebGUI::Session::DateTime;
|
||||
use WebGUI::Session::Env;
|
||||
use WebGUI::Session::ErrorHandler;
|
||||
use WebGUI::Session::Form;
|
||||
use WebGUI::Session::Http;
|
||||
use WebGUI::Session::Os;
|
||||
use WebGUI::Session::Privilege;
|
||||
use WebGUI::Session::Scratch;
|
||||
use WebGUI::Session::Setting;
|
||||
use WebGUI::Session::Stow;
|
||||
|
|
@ -132,6 +134,22 @@ sub config {
|
|||
}
|
||||
|
||||
|
||||
#-------------------------------------------------------------------
|
||||
|
||||
=head2 datetime ()
|
||||
|
||||
Returns a WebGUI::Session::DateTime object.
|
||||
|
||||
=cut
|
||||
|
||||
sub datetime {
|
||||
my $self = shift;
|
||||
if (exists $self->{_datetime}) {
|
||||
$self->{_datetime} = WebGUI::Session::DateTime->new($session);
|
||||
}
|
||||
return $self->{_datetime};
|
||||
}
|
||||
|
||||
#-------------------------------------------------------------------
|
||||
|
||||
=head2 db ( )
|
||||
|
|
@ -296,6 +314,22 @@ sub os {
|
|||
}
|
||||
|
||||
|
||||
#-------------------------------------------------------------------
|
||||
|
||||
=head2 privilege ( )
|
||||
|
||||
Returns a WebGUI::Session::Privilege object.
|
||||
|
||||
=cut
|
||||
|
||||
sub privilege {
|
||||
my $self = shift;
|
||||
unless (exists $self->{_privilege}) {
|
||||
$self->{_privilege} = WebGUI::Session::Privilege->new($session);
|
||||
}
|
||||
return $self->{_privilege};
|
||||
}
|
||||
|
||||
#-------------------------------------------------------------------
|
||||
|
||||
=head2 request ( )
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ue